Company Description

Precision Electronic Services has been specializing in sales, support, and repair of industrial controls for over 40 years. Our highly trained staff, expertise, and advanced equipment ensure top-quality electronic control and servo motor repair services. At PES, we remanufacture defective units by replacing aged components and those known to fail, extending the life of the equipment and driving cost savings for our customers. We provide a two-year repair warranty on all repairs. Our services include AC and DC drive repair, PLC repair, HMI panel repair, and repair of other industrial controls across major brands such as Allen-Bradley, Siemens, Mitsubishi, and more.


Role Description

This is a full-time, on-site role for a Senior Electronic Technician at our Danville, VA facility. In this position, you will diagnose, repair, and test a wide range of industrial electronic controls used in manufacturing and automation environments. Work includes troubleshooting down to the component level, replacing electronic components, performing soldering and rework, and confirming proper operation through testing.


This role offers exposure to a variety of equipment and control technologies, including AC/DC drives, PLCs, HMIs, and servo systems. It requires strong technical judgment, attention to detail, and independent problem-solving. You will work at a dedicated bench, use professional-grade test equipment, and collaborate with a highly experienced team while contributing to efficient and high-quality repair operations.


This position is ideal for technicians who enjoy hands-on electronics work, diagnosing faults rather than replacing boards, and supporting the uptime and reliability of industrial equipment.
